Omron G7J Series Power Relay, 24V Coil Voltage, 25A Switching Current - G7J-3A1B-P 24VDC


This power relay is a PCB-mounted switching device designed for industrial automation and control applications. It provides electrical isolation between control and load circuits and is suitable for systems requiring moderate to high current switching in both AC and DC circuits. The component is configured to fit through-hole PCB layouts and operates within a typical industrial ambient range.

Features and Benefits:


• 24V DC Coil consuming 2W reduces drive power requirements
• Coil resistance 288Ω enables predictable Coil current draw
• Silver-alloy contacts maintain low contact resistance 100mΩ
• Switching capability 25A at 250V AC supports heavy loads
• Able to switch 125V DC for DC load handling
• Terminal style designed for direct PCB solder mounting

What ambient temperatures can it tolerate in service?


It operates reliably from -25°C to 60°C, covering typical indoor industrial environments and many non-climate-controlled enclosures.

How does the contact configuration affect wiring options?


The relay offers three normally open poles Plus a single normally closed pole, allowing multiplexed switching arrangements and combination control of multiple circuits from a single coil.

What approvals support its use in compliant installations?


It carries both UL and CSA approvals, which assist specification in systems where recognised safety listings are required.

How Compact is the footprint for PCB layout planning?


The component occupies a concise profile measuring 51mm by 34.5mm, facilitating integration into constrained PCB real estate.
